A language consultancy seeks a Native English Language Expert to improve language-centric projects remotely. The candidate will conduct linguistic analysis, review and proofread content, and collaborate with teams to enhance communication.
This role requires native English proficiency, attention to detail, and experience in linguistic analysis. An ideal applicant will hold a relevant degree and be passionate about language accuracy, contributing to high-impact projects from anywhere.
